Description

Job objectives and responsibilities
-
To support the Admin and Helpdesk team working in two locations
  • Central London (2 days) and Feltham (3 days).
-
To support Senior Operations Manager (Soft Services) and Site Operations Manager (Hard Services), undertaking tasks as required within role competencies

Main duties

  • *
General duties to include the support and ownership towards:

  • *

  • Answering the telephone and address enquiries to the site team, logging customer calls on Maximo.
-
Raise reactive call outs on Maximo along with quotations/cost estimates to the client.
-
Closing jobs down in Maximo and attach documents where necessary
-
Raise Project Numbers and Purchase Orders as required.
-
Approve To Pay purchase orders on a periodic basis throughout the week.
-
Co-ordinate subcontractor reactive calls ensuring that calls are promptly responded to and closed off where necessary.
-
Liaise with Subcontractors regarding Reactive and Quoted Works where necessary.
-
Assist in the end of year supplier renewal quotes and the raising of PO's as necessary.
-
General Administration.
-
Adhoc reports required by the contract management.
-
Provide cover for the Site Operations Manager when absent from the office (Annual Leave/Sickness).
-
Assisting with producing necessary documentation for audits and filing/archiving when required.
-
Performance (trackers) updates/Reports when required.
-
Assist with Month End responsibilities as directed - journals, invoicing, accruals, WIP & MI reporting.
-
To ensure the company Health and Safety policy is adhered to.
-
To ensure compliance with the Business Quality Management Systems as it applies to this position.
-
To understand and complete all work related documentation accurately and on time for the Client and Site Management Team
-
Maintain good communications with the client and internal teams at all times.
-
To undertake additional duties in line with capabilities as required.
-
To attend Team Briefs with all to ensure cascading of company information/policy and discussing contract performance.
-
Ensure that all training is attended and completed in line with company and individual requirements.
-
Ensure that a good understanding of the contract is achieved and that time is made available to get familiar with documentation and manuals required to fulfil the role.
-
To ensure that all documentation relating to the administration are uploaded and attached to all Work Orders in Maximo/central files; to provide record keeping and visibility to the Client, Operations Teams and Management Teams.
-
Administer filing for purchase orders, WIP, Quotations.
-
Maintain an up to date asset list for uniform and work related equipment.
